Transaction 8a595381f7d54dc36c9571c90ef0678f39957ef71f6ba59bf2949f012f4185c2
1 Input
1 Output
-
8a595381f7d54dc36c9571c90ef0678f39957ef71f6ba59bf2949f012f4185c2:0
- value
- 64702213
- script pubkey
- OP_0 OP_PUSHBYTES_20 95160bd324ab96edad4523020c29fe59b2d0579c
- address
- bc1qj5tqh5ey4wtwmt29yvpqc207txedq4uupkn6ee